visual studio 2012无法识别代码中的更改

问题描述:

由于某些原因,visual studio(2012)未读取我的代码中的任何更改。它会识别出一个错误,但是,例如,如果我摆脱出现使窗口出现的东西,窗口仍然会出现。我也无法调试我的代码(我得到了'未加载此文档的符号'错误)。这已经持续了几天。visual studio 2012无法识别代码中的更改

我不太确定该怎么做。我清除了视觉工作室缓存,但没有帮助。我已经改变了启动项目设置,但是这也没有改变任何东西。这全部来自我的本地机器(无源/版本控制)。有人知道为什么吗?

我解决了这个问题通过删除名为.suo(Silverlight的用户选项)文件,如下面的链接建议,感谢@amalgamate

http://www.kunal-chowdhury.com/2011/08/why-visual-studio-debugger-is-not.html

+0

试试这个简单的修复,可能是解决您的问题。 [配置管理器中选中的项目] [1] [1]:http://*.com/questions/22726034/visual-studio-2012-not-detecting-file-changes –

这可能不是你的答案,我不知道银光,但是当解决方案文件丢失跟踪项目文件的位置,或者项目文件丢失了库的轨道时,我经常发现符号未加载错误。也许文件丢失了,或者你的团队中的其他人指示了它在其他地方等等。要在项目浏览器中解决此问题,请右键单击解决方案或项目并重新添加特定的引用或项目(使用添加菜单项) 。然后您可能必须删除旧的项目/或参考。你会知道参考和项目是坏的,因为它们在项目浏览器旁边的图标。错误的链接也将列在你的版本的输出中,并命名为不良链接。

+0

我已经多次重新添加项目引用 - 无济于事 – user2084666

+0

也许它们是对未找到的.NET文件的引用。您是否在针对正确的版本进行构建?您可以在“目标框架”字段下的应用程序选项卡下的属性中调整此属性。你是否安装了多个.NET框架? – amalgamate

+0

我在我的机器上只有4.5,目标框架是4.5 – user2084666

尝试建立>然后清理解决方案构建

+0

都能跟得上 - 仍在表现得像我没有做任何改变 – user2084666

+0

@ user2084666你有没有尝试重新启动VS? –

+0

这已经持​​续了几天,视觉工作室已经多次重启 - 我的电脑 – user2084666